Released: 1993 and 1996 Label: 4AD Genre: Alternative 4AD will reissue the final two Cocteau Twins albums to U.S. consumers tomorrow. The releases include vinyl pressings for the first time in that country. Four-Calendar Café and Milk & Kisses closed out the trio’s recording career in sparkling form. Andrew Spackman has made music under multiple names, including his own. In addition to his recent contribution to the Mortality Tables series, he has a new 20-track LP out as The Dark Jazz Project.
